Can I Repel Cats Using Certain Smells or Deterrents?
Many cat owners swear by the effectiveness of specific smells and deterrents in repelling feline invaders. Citrus-based sprays, vinegar-soaked rags, and ultrasonic devices are among the most popular solutions.
